The Mystery of the Enchanted Crypt (Original title: El misterio de la cripta embrujada, 1979) is a hilarious novel that has its roots in the Spanish picaresque genre. It opens with the mysterious disappearance of several teenagers from the convent school of the Lazaristas Mothers of San Gervasio in Barcelona. The investigation is narrated by an unnamed inmate from a mental hospital who is forced to help the police in order to solve the case.
The action takes place within a few days in the spring of 1977, six years after the disappearance of the first girl in the school; it has a linear structure and nineteen chapters written in chronological order. In the first two we learned what has happened; chapters three to eighteen are devoted to the investigation and in the last chapter we arrived at the solution.
